A demonstration of user feedback concerning items available for purchase on a prominent e-commerce platform provides valuable insight into customer experiences. These examples typically showcase varying levels of satisfaction, highlighting both positive and negative aspects of a product’s features, functionality, and overall value. A fabricated customer’s account of a recently purchased Bluetooth speaker, for instance, might detail its ease of use, sound quality, and battery life, or conversely, express concerns regarding its durability or connectivity issues.
These illustrative instances are critical for potential buyers seeking to make informed decisions. They offer a glimpse into the real-world performance of products, supplementing manufacturer descriptions and specifications. Historically, such assessments relied on word-of-mouth or limited access to expert opinions. The advent of online marketplaces has democratized access to this type of information, enabling a wider audience to contribute their experiences and influence consumer behavior. This access directly impacts purchasing decisions and influences a product’s reputation.
